María del Rosario Orozco is a Guatemalan public health official currently serving as the Deputy Minister of Hospitals. In her role, she is responsible for overseeing hospital operations and implementing health policies. Recently, she has been in the news for announcing the opening of the Hospital de Amatitlán, which will provide essential services including outpatient consultations, emergency care, and maternity services, particularly focusing on primary care and neonatal emergencies following significant seismic damage to healthcare facilities in the region.
